Overview

JPMorgan American’s objective is to provide shareholders with capital growth from North American investments. In order to achieve its investment objectives and to seek to manage risk, the company mainly invests in a diversified portfolio of quoted companies including, when appropriate, exposure to smaller capitalisation stocks. JPMorgan American currently has separate portfolios dedicated to larger capitalisation and smaller capitalisation exposure. The number of investments in the larger capitalisation portfolio will normally range between 60-100 stocks representing between 80-100% of the equity portfolio. The number of investments in the smaller capitalisation portfolio will normally range between 100-120 stocks representing between 0-20% of the equity portfolio. JPMorgan American may invest in pooled funds to achieve these aims.
